I'm a free-lancer running heavy electrics, and modified diesels. How do I choose details, expecially plows and know that they will work on my models? for starts I have several E-60's (new and old bachmans, and a few American GK units) that need plows for and aft...
 
Go to Walthers and check out the Cal Scale and Details West lines of detail parts. They have a ton of different plows with the dimensions. Just find one that fits your pilot and you're good to go.
 
Easiest thing to do is pick a prototype, look at photos, and start looking for the parts you see on their units.
 


Plows for Diesel & electric should be the same. It jsut depends on how large of a plow you want!
